Instruction & Operating Manual

TA-15/6P...200/6P

Terminal 7 and 8

Terminals for contacts of all malfunction signals. (Contacts open in event of fault)

Terminal 2, 5, 6

Speed potentiometer

With this potentiometer the speed is infinite variable from minimum to maximum

speed.
Poti-connect: KL. 5 = Beginning

KL. 6 = End

KL. 2 = Connect center

Terminal 13

Current reference signal output

Terminal 18

Current reference signal input

Terminal 13 and 18

For speed control these terminals must be jumpered

Terminal 17

Reference signal (negative) 0-max. 200V

depending on value of resistor R83

General input voltage 0-10V

Terminal 19 and 20

Terminals for connection of a.c. tachometer

Output voltage of tachometer approximately 100-150V at rated motor speed.

Terminal 11 and 20

Terminals for connection of d.c. tachometer
KL. 11 = Negative
KL. 20 = Positive

The adaption of the tachometer signal is achieved by changing the value of

resistor R91.
R91 is calculated as follows:
R91 in kOhm = tachometer voltage at rated motor speed minus 50

Terminal 22 and 23

Relay contacts (normally open, no potential)

(for operation of auxiliary armature solenoid.)

Terminal 24 and 25

Terminals for quick-stop (normally closed)

Terminal L1 and N

Terminals for connection of fan 230V VAC, 50/60Hz at TA-60/6P

2.3 Terminal Strip KL. 2

 (Only at TA-40/6P available)

Terminal 3 and 4

Terminals for connection of fan 230V VAC, 50/60Hz
